Brief Summary

This study is investigating the effects of a home-based resistance exercise program, administered via an interactive telecommunications system, in functionally limited older veterans.

Outcome Measures

Primary Outcomes (5)

  • Knee Extension Strength

    The peak force measured during the bilateral knee extension exercise against the highest level of a hydraulic resistance system

    6 months

  • Knee Flexion Strength

    The peak force measured during the bilateral knee flexion exercise against the highest level of a hydraulic resistance system

    6 months

  • Single Leg Stance With Eyes Open

    Length of time standing on one leg without moving the support foot, touching the floor or support leg with suspended foot, or requiring assistance.

    6 months

  • Tandem Stance

    Length of time standing with the heel of one foot touching the toe of the other foot keeping the feet in a straight line.

    6 months

  • Six-minute Walk

    Total distance walked during 6 minutes. Subjects were instructed to walk up and down a 100-foot level hallway as far as they could in 6 minutes.

    6 months
